Music & Lyrics by Stephen Sondheim | Book by Burt Shevelove & Larry Gelbart | Based on the plays of Plautus
Sondheim's hilarious farce set in ancient rome tells a story of love, freedom and mistaken identities.
Tragedy tomorrow, Comedy tonight!
A Funny Thing Happened on the Way to the Forum is best known for being the inspiration of Up Pompeii with Frankie Howerd. It is Sondheim’s first musical but one of the least performed. Set in classical Rome, it is a musical comedy based on the comedies by the Roman playwright Plautus.

Synopsis
Act One: Pseudolus, a slave, is promised his freedom by his master’s son (Hero), if he acquires the courtesan (Philia) whom Hero is in love with. Unfortunately, Philia has already been sold to a Captain (Miles Gloriosus) who will collect her later that day. Pseudolus tells Philia’s owner (Lycus), that she has the plague, and offers to look after her until the Captain comes. Hero’s father (Senex) finds Philia in his house and is told by Pseudolus that she is the new maid. Miles Gloriosus arrives and demands his bride and threatens to kill Pseudolus if he cannot produce her.
Act Two starts with Miles in Senex’s house waiting for Pseudolus to produce his bride. Pseudolus pretends that Philia has died of the plague, and persuades his fellow slave (Hysterium) to act as her body. Miles demands a funeral, during which he discovers that the body is not dead. After a chase scene and many mistaken identities, it is uncovered that Miles and Philia are brother and sister, so they cannot marry and Hero can therefore have his love, and Pseudolus his freedom.
